I've wanted this game since I was a kid reading my Nintendo Power magazines religiously. At the tail end of the n64s life this game came out. I didn't have enough money at the time, and by the time I did, not only did I realize it was only at Blockbuster video (very much like Indiana Jones), but due to the n64s sudden death as soon as the word "GameCube" was uttered, all gone.

 

That game is Stunt Racer 64. Until today I've NEVER seen a copy in the wild. Most auctions got for over fifty bucks even if the kabek has been torn off completely from the blockbuster label.

 

I found mine today in a new store I ventured in. I got it for 20 bucks. Also got rampage and captain silver for the master system for five each, crash n burn for 3do for eleven, and star soldier on the n64 for four dollars.

 

But by far this was the star of the pick up. I've never resorted to auctions on this game. I vowed to find it on my own. After all this time I got it. Can't explain how excited and happy I am.

Thanks guys. Unlike Indiana Jones this game is actually very good. Sorry, I know everyone loves that game but I thought it was clunky. Stunt racer 64 is a hoot. It's simple, but the controls are a lot of fun. Doing drifts and performing flips is insanely gratifying. The backgrounds are good too.

 

I will say though that crash n burn on the 3do might be even better. The fully textured polygonal backgrounds are stunning and honestly put stunt racer to shame graphically. Why some people still think its a fmv racer is beyond me. The game clearly isn't or the frames would get worse when slowing down as the movie was going slower. That and you can tell if youre used to 3do graphics what polygons look like verses something prerendered, and you can move side to side on the track which changes the perspective instead of the background staying the same no matter where you drive on the road.
